soaring on a landscaped site in jyväskylä, finland, ”villa muurame’ is an all-timber private residence conceived by marco casagrande. the stark white construction uses a combination of high-quality pine and spruce woods; the spatial elements were pre-fabricated during the winter in the finnish lapland then transported to site. the three-storey scheme sits by a lake, with each floor containing its own terrace to embrace its surroundings.

marco casagrande planned the property with elongated sections of vertical and horizontal forms which connect the home in a dramatic but restrained fashion. internally, the bright and airy atmosphere is promoted by the large windows which invite natural light, whilst leading the eye towards the property’s expansive garden. a succession of multi-connected spaces influence a sense of movement. the private rooms are located on the upper levels, meanwhile the communal areas are grouped together on the ground floor.

the sloping roof canopy extends outwards to provide shelter for each balcony of all the floors and the outdoor patio. the overall result is a naturally lit, spacious and thermally comfortable house powered by geothermal energy that can be inhabited year round without excessive artificial heating, cooling and lighting.

project info:
location: jyväskylä, finland
function: private house
client: muurametalot
size: 350 m2
materials: pine, spruce
construction principle: pre-fabricated spatial elements
completed: 2014
